Audio Control Switch Operation
When the audio unit is turned on, operation of the audio unit from the steering wheel is possible.
NOTE:
Because the audio unit will be turned off under
the following conditions, the switches will be
inoperable.
- When the ignition is turned off (LOCK).
- When the power button on the audio unit is pressed and the audio unit is turned off.
- When the CD being played is ejected and the audio unit is turned off.

Adjusting the Volume
To increase the volume, pull up the volume switch.
To decrease the volume, press down the volume switch.

Changing the Source
Press the mode switch () to
change
the audio source (FM1 radio> FM2 radio>
AM radio> CD player or CD changer>
SIRIUS1> SIRIUS2> SIRIUS3> AUX>
BT audio> cyclical).

Seek Switch
Without Bluetooth Hands-Free and navigation system
With Bluetooth Hands-Free only/ Bluetooth Hands-Free and navigation system
When listening to the radio or SIRIUS digital satellite radio
Pull up or press down the seek switch, the radio switches to the next/previous stored station in the order that it was stored (1―6).
Pull up or press down the seek switch for about 2 seconds until a beep sound is heard to seek all usable stations at a higher or lower frequency whether programmed or not.
When playing a CD or BT audio
Pull up the seek switch to skip to the next track.
Press down the seek switch to repeat the current track.
Pull up or press down and hold the seek switch to continuously switch the tracks up or down.
Mute Switch
Press the mute switch ()
once to mute
audio, press it again to resume audio
output.
NOTE:
If the ignition is turned off (LOCK) with the
audio muted, the mute will be canceled.
Therefore, when the engine is restarted, the audio is not muted. To mute the audio again, press the mute switch (
).
